What is the purpose of vaccines?
The purpose of vaccines is to induce a specific primary immune response so that the next time the disease is encountered, a secondary response will be launched
What type of immunity can vaccines lead to?
Vaccines can lead to herd immunity, where diseases become sporadic
What is passive immunity?
Passive immunity is when you receive antibodies from another source
What is a natural and artificial example of passive immunity?
Natural acquired
Getting immunity from antibodies passed in breast milk or placenta
Artificial acquired
Getting immunity from antibodies harvested from another person or animal (antivenom)

What is active immunity?
Active immunity is when your body produces its own antibodies
What is a natural and artificial example of active immunity?
Natural acquired
Immunity gained through illness and recovery
Artificial acquired
Immunity gained through a vaccine

What are the 5 types of vaccines?
Live, attenuated (weakened) vaccines
Inactivated killed vaccines
Subunit vaccines
Conjugated vaccines
Nucleic acid vaccines
What are Live, attenuated (weakened) vaccines for and some examples of this?
Live, attenuated vaccines are typically for viruses
Examples: MMR vaccine for measles, Influenza vaccine (nasal spray)
What are inactivated killed vaccines for and some examples of this?
Inactivated killed vaccines are typically for viruses and bacteria and require boosters
Examples: Hepatitis A, Influenza vaccine (injection)
What are Subunit vaccines and some examples of this?
Subunit vaccines contain fragments of the microbe and are typically for viruses and bacteria
Examples: Hepatitis B, HPV (both capsid fragments)
What do Conjugated vaccines do and what is an example of this?
Conjugated vaccines link polysaccharides to another protein, resulting in a strong immune response
Example: Haemophilus influenzae vaccine (meningitis)
What do nucleic acid vaccines do and examples of this?
Nucleic acid vaccines make protein antigens from DNA or mRNA, activating cellular and humoral immunity
Examples: West nile viruses (horses), Zika, Covid-19
